Resolve, To Honor Margaret Chase Smith And Joshua Chamberlain In The National Statuary Hall

This Maine legislative resolve (LD 1648) directs Maine's arts, museum, and preservation commissions to request Congress replace two statues in the National Statuary Hall (currently of Hannibal Hamlin and William King) with statues of Margaret Chase Smith and Joshua Chamberlain. If Congress approves, the commissions must install the new statues within a year and relocate the old statues to public display at the Maine State House or its grounds. The bill does not alter laws but outlines a procedural process for honoring these historical figures through statue placement. It directly affects Maine's state commissions and the National Statuary Hall Collection.
